Ce service de surveillance entièrement géré et facile à utiliser s'appuie sur le même datastore global évolutif que Google Cloud.
Lancez-vous sans avoir recours à une migration complexe
Basé sur le backend Google qui collecte plus de 2 000 milliards de séries temporelles actives
Découvrez des témoignages de clients
Découvrez les nouveautés du service
Avantages
Pile de surveillance compatible avec Prometheus® entièrement gérée avec une durée de conservation par défaut de deux ans et des requêtes globales sur les données régionalisées. Vous n'avez pas besoin de fédérer, d'ajouter des ressources manuellement ni de consacrer du temps à la maintenance.
Segmenter une empreinte de stockage en expansion est une tâche complexe quand vous exécutez votre propre agrégateur compatible avec Prometheus. Pour vous éviter ce problème, toutes les métriques sont stockées pendant deux ans sans frais supplémentaires.
Utilisez PromQL avec Cloud Monitoring et des outils Open Source comme Grafana®. Configurez le déploiement et le scraping via n'importe quelle méthode Open Source, telle que les opérateurs ou les annotations Prometheus.
Principales fonctionnalités
Managed Service pour Prometheus exploite la même technologie que Google pour surveiller ses propres services. Ainsi, même les déploiements Prometheus les plus volumineux peuvent être surveillés à l'échelle mondiale. De plus, le service est géré par l'équipe d'ingénierie en fiabilité des sites (SRE) qui assure la surveillance de Google. Vous pouvez donc être sûr que vos métriques seront disponibles lorsque vous en aurez besoin.
Vous pouvez consulter simultanément les métriques de Prometheus et de plus de 1 500 métriques du système Google Cloud sans frais pour obtenir une vue centralisée de votre infrastructure et de vos applications. Les métriques Prometheus peuvent être utilisées avec les fonctionnalités de tableau de bord, d'alertes et de surveillance SLO dans Cloud Monitoring. Affichez vos métriques Prometheus en même temps que vos métriques GKE, vos métriques d'équilibreur de charge, etc. Cloud Monitoring est compatible avec PromQL, ce qui permet à vos développeurs de commencer à l'utiliser immédiatement.
Managed Service pour Prometheus propose des collecteurs gérés qui sont automatiquement déployés, adaptés, segmentés, configurés et conservés. Le scraping et les règles sont configurés via des ressources personnalisées légères. La migration à partir d'un opérateur Prometheus est simple, et la collecte gérée est compatible avec la plupart des cas d'utilisation. Vous pouvez également conserver votre méthode et vos configurations de déploiement de collecteurs existants si les collecteurs gérés ne sont actuellement pas compatibles avec votre cas d'utilisation. L'agent Ops simplifie la collecte de métriques Prometheus sur les machines virtuelles pour vous permettre de standardiser plus facilement tous les environnements sur Prometheus.
Clients
Nouveautés
Inscrivez-vous à la newsletter Google Cloud pour recevoir des informations sur les produits et événements, des offres spéciales et bien plus encore.
Documentation
Cas d'utilisation
Utilisez PromQL pour définir des alertes et diagnostiquer les problèmes lorsque celles-ci sont déclenchées. Avec Managed Service pour Prometheus, vous n'avez pas besoin de modifier vos outils de visualisation ni vos alertes. Vos workflows de création et d'enquête existants continuent ainsi de fonctionner.
Managed Service pour Prometheus est facturé par échantillon, aucuns frais n'est facturé à l'avance pour la cardinalité lors de l'exécution d'un nouveau conteneur. Grâce à la tarification par échantillon, vous ne payez que lorsque le conteneur est actif, et vous n'êtes pas pénalisé pour l'utilisation de l'autoscaling horizontal des pods. Managed Service pour Prometheus vous permet de maîtriser les coûts grâce à d'autres contrôles personnalisables tels que des périodes d'échantillonnage, des filtres et la possibilité de conserver les données en local, sans les envoyer au datastore.
L'adoption d'une norme de métriques dans vos déploiements Kubernetes, de VM et sans serveur facilite le regroupement de tableaux de bord pour une meilleure surveillance. De plus, les développeurs et les administrateurs n'ont besoin que de connaître le protocole PromQL pour travailler avec vos métriques. Le service géré pour Prometheus fonctionne avec ce cas d'utilisation avec des options de collecte pour GKE, Cloud Run et l'agent Ops pour les VM sur Google Cloud.
Toutes les fonctionnalités
Évaluateur autonome de règles globales | Vous pouvez continuer à évaluer vos règles d'enregistrement et d'alerte existantes par rapport à des données globales avec Managed Service pour Prometheus. Les résultats sont stockés de la même façon que les données collectées. Vous n'avez donc pas besoin de colocaliser les données agrégées sur un seul serveur Prometheus. |
Surveillance dynamique multiprojet | Les champs d'application des métriques sont une structure en lecture seule dans Cloud Monitoring qui vous permet de surveiller plusieurs projets à partir d'une seule source de données Grafana. Chaque champ d'application de métrique apparaît sous la forme d'une source de données distincte dans Grafana. Vous pouvez lui attribuer des autorisations de lecture par compte de service. |
Collecteurs gérés | Les collecteurs gérés sont automatiquement déployés, mis à l'échelle, segmentés, configurés et conservés. Le scraping et les règles sont configurés via des ressources personnalisées légères. |
Collecteurs autodéployés | Utilisez le mécanisme de déploiement que vous préférez en remplaçant simplement le binaire Prometheus standard de Managed Service par celui du collecteur Prometheus. Le scraping est configuré selon la méthode standard de votre choix, et vous pouvez effectuer un scaling et un partitionnement manuellement. Réutilisez vos configurations existantes et exécutez côte à côte Prometheus et Managed Service pour Prometheus. |
Side-car Prometheus pour Cloud Run | Obtenez une surveillance de type Prometheus pour les services Cloud Run en ajoutant le side-car. Le side-car utilise Google Cloud Managed Service pour Prometheus côté serveur et une distribution d'OpenTelemetry Collector, personnalisée pour les charges de travail sans serveur, côté client. |
Assistance pour la surveillance d'environnements supplémentaires | Vous pouvez configurer des collecteurs autodéployés pour collecter des données à partir d'applications exécutées en dehors de Google Cloud. Il peut s'agir d'environnements Kubernetes ou non Kubernetes, tels que des VM. |
Utilisez PromQL dans Cloud Monitoring | Utilisez PromQL dans l'interface utilisateur de Cloud Monitoring, y compris dans l'explorateur de métriques et le générateur de tableau de bord. Obtenez une saisie semi-automatique du nom des métriques, ainsi que des clés et des valeurs d'étiquettes. Interrogez les métriques système gratuites, les métriques Kubernetes, les métriques basées sur les journaux et les métriques personnalisées, ainsi que vos métriques Prometheus avec PromQL. |
S'appuie sur Monarch, la base de données de séries temporelles en mémoire de Google | Le service utilise la même technologie que Google pour surveiller ses propres services. Cela signifie que même les déploiements Prometheus les plus volumineux peuvent être surveillés à l'échelle mondiale. |
Mécanismes de contrôle des coûts | Contrôlez vos dépenses grâce au filtre de métriques exportées, aux frais réduits liés aux histogrammes creux, à la facturation moins coûteuse pour les périodes d'échantillonnage plus longues et à la possibilité de n'envoyer que des données pré-agrégées en local. |
Identification et attribution des coûts | Utilisez Cloud Monitoring pour ventiler le volume d'ingestion Prometheus par nom de métrique et espace de noms. Identifiez rapidement les métriques qui vous coûtent le plus cher et l'espace de noms qui les envoie. |
Exemple : Migration à chaud des VM | Exemple : Les machines virtuelles Compute Engine peuvent migrer à chaud entre les systèmes hôtes sans redémarrage, ce qui permet à vos applications de s'exécuter même lorsque les systèmes hôtes nécessitent une maintenance. |
Tarification
La tarification de Managed Service pour Prometheus vous permet de contrôler votre utilisation et vos dépenses. Pour en savoir plus, consultez la grille tarifaire.
Caractéristique | Prix | Attribution gratuite par mois | Date d'entrée en vigueur |
---|---|---|---|
Métriques ingérées à l'aide de Google Cloud Managed Service pour Prometheus | 0,060 $/million d'échantillons† : premiers 0 à 50 milliards d'échantillons# 0,048 $/million d'échantillons : 50 à 250 milliards d'échantillons suivants 0,036 $/million d'échantillons : 250 à 500 milliards d'échantillons suivants 0,024 $/million d'échantillons : > 500 milliards d'échantillons | Non applicable | 8 août 2023 |
Appels d'API Monitoring | 0,01 $/1 000 appels d'API en lecture (Les appels d'API en écriture sont gratuits) | Premier million d'appels d'API en lecture inclus (par compte de facturation) | 1er juillet 2018 |
†Google Cloud Managed Service pour Prometheus utilise l'espace de stockage de Cloud Monitoring pour stocker les données de métriques créées en externe, et récupère ces données à l'aide de l'API Monitoring.Managed Service pour Prometheus effectue des mesures basées sur les échantillons ingérés au lieu des octets, conformément aux conventions de Prometheus.Pour en savoir plus sur la mesure basée sur les échantillons, consultez la section Tarifs pour la contrôlabilité et la prédictibilité. Pour obtenir des exemples de calcul, consultez la section Exemples de tarification basés sur les échantillons ingérés.
# Les échantillons sont comptabilisés par compte de facturation.
Les marques Grafana Labs sont des marques de Grafana Labs. Elles sont utilisées avec l'autorisation de Grafana Labs. Nous ne sommes ni affiliés, ni approuvés, ni sponsorisés par Grafana Labs ou ses sociétés affiliées.
Profitez de 300 $ de crédits gratuits et de plus de 20 produits Always Free pour commencer à créer des applications sur Google Cloud.